Re: boot.conf timeout ignored on amd64?
On Fri, Jan 27, 2006 at 06:05:16PM +0100, Toni Mueller wrote: > - /etc/boot.conf --- > set timeout 30 > boot /bsd.mpr > ----- /etc/boot.conf --- The "boot" commands instructs it to boot there and then.
Re: boot.conf timeout ignored on amd64?
On 2006/01/27 17:30, John Wright wrote: > On Fri, Jan 27, 2006 at 06:05:16PM +0100, Toni Mueller wrote: > > ----- /etc/boot.conf --- > > set timeout 30 > > boot /bsd.mpr > > - /etc/boot.conf --- > > The "boot" commands instructs it to boot there and then. 'set image' is probably what's wanted instead.
Re: boot.conf timeout ignored on amd64?
On Friday, January 27, Toni Mueller wrote: > > - /etc/boot.conf --- > set timeout 30 > boot /bsd.mpr > - /etc/boot.conf --- > > This should give me a 30 second pause before the machine boots the > named kernel, but instead, it boots _immediately_, so I have no time to > make up my mind to choose a different kernel. What am I doing wrong? No, boot.conf is just as if you had typed the stuff on the command line. When you say 'boot foo', the bootblocks go ahead, and boot foo. No wait. No sleep. What you want is something like: set timeout 30 set image /bsd.mpr --Toby.

Re: sysupgrade failure due to boot.conf
Theo wrote: > Figure out how to build and install. It is not hard to test. Thank you, I did as you suggested and I was able to narrow down the issue to this line of code in /usr/src/sys/arch/amd64/stand/efiboot/efiboot.c: EFI_CALL(ST->RuntimeServices->GetTime, &t, NULL); The GetTime call would always return the same time. It turned out that my BIOS clock was frozen and was not ticking so the boot prompt was waiting for a time that never arrived. I learned a lot about OpenBSD efiboot and a good BIOS lesson. Always use the clear CMOS hardware jumper after a BIOS update. I have been using the "Load defaults" in the BIOS after a BIOS update but that is not good enough. Re: sysupgrade failure due to boot.conf
Theo wrote: > Interesting. Wonder how common this is. It could possibly come back in some future bios update bug/change as well but very very rarely I would expect. This problem showed up for me in a different way as well; My clock would always drift and ntpd would report that it was always trying to adjust the clock but would never get closer to the target time. Now I can explain why since my bios clock was stuck. > Should our code eventually advance if it has done millions of inspection loops? I saw code in there in /usr/src/sys/stand/boot/cmd.c that counted 1000 before calling getsecs() so I would weary about adding more counts: /* check for timeout expiration less often (for some very constrained archs) */ while (!cnischar()) if (!(i++ % 1000) && (getsecs() >= tt)) break; I don't know the amd64 architecture too well but I would think there would be a more reliable timer that can be used instead of the system clock. Only relative time is needed for the timeout to operate correctly. Or possibly use some known tick. http://books.gigatux.nl/mirror/kerneldevelopment/0672327201/ch10lev1sec2.html > If you can re-create the condition, can you propose a diff which does that? Re: use boot.conf boot into GENERIC.MP with the 5 second pause at boot-time
On 17:19, Mon 16 Jun 08, Dongsheng Song wrote: > I use a amd64 MP server, default boot into GENERIC, not GENERIC.MP. > > I can use boot.conf boot into GENERIC.MP, but this remove the 5 > second pause at boot-time. > > How can I default boot into GENERIC.MP, and not remove the 5 second > pause at boot-time? > > Thanks for some help, > > Dongsheng Song > cd / && mv bsd bsd.up && mv bsd.mp bsd && reboot -- Michiel van Baak [EMAIL PROTECTED] http://michiel.vanbaak.eu GnuPG key: http://pgp.mit.edu:11371/pks/lookup?op=get&search=0x71C946BD "Why is it drug addicts and computer aficionados are both called users?"
Re: use boot.conf boot into GENERIC.MP with the 5 second pause at boot-time
On Mon, Jun 16, 2008 at 05:19:16PM +0800, Dongsheng Song wrote: | I use a amd64 MP server, default boot into GENERIC, not GENERIC.MP. | | I can use boot.conf boot into GENERIC.MP, but this remove the 5 | second pause at boot-time. Then you probably have the following boot.conf : boot bsd.mp You may want to change it to : set image bsd.mp This is what I do on my MP systems. You should be aware of the fact that this "breaks" make install for your own kernel builds, but this may not be an issue for you. | How can I default boot into GENERIC.MP, and not remove the 5 second | pause at boot-time? Read boot.conf(5) for more details. You can even configure the timeout in there. Cheers, Paul 'WEiRD' de Weerd -- >[<++>-]<+++.>+++[<-->-]<.>+++[<+ +++>-]<.>++[<>-]<+.--.[-] http://www.weirdnet.nl/
